    Liverpool boss Jurgen Klopp on Brentford :
    The football they play is incredible and the organisation is incredible so Thomas and Brentford is doing an incredible job. They show even with less money you can create something really special.

    They are incredibly well-drilled football team. Everyone knows what to do, everyone is ready to make the extra yard. I saw them celebrating after the Arsenal game which was absolutely great to see how much it meant to them and we know what we have to expect them.

    The whole team defends like it's the last game of their lives and that is really impressive. Congratulations on that so far. The start they had is really good and I'm pretty sure they are not satisfied yet.

    It will be an interesting game because two really lively high intense teams will face each other. The home team has the crowd on their back and we have to make sure that we can calm the atmosphere a little bit down only for that day because apart from that I am completely fine that they have the best season of their lives because I really like what they do.

    guardian:
    Brentford prepare for their first meeting with one of the Premier League’s elite and, having put plenty of credit in the bank with eight points from five games, they have earned the right to a proper go at Liverpool.

    Entertainment seems guaranteed and both defences will be gainfully occupied.

    Sadio Mané and Mohamed Salah have begun this season with purpose, even by their high standards. With 24 and 22 attempts at goal respectively, the pair have comfortably outshot anyone else in the division and scored seven between them. Although Brentford’s Ivan Toney and Bryan Mbuemo have not let fly as often, they will present a handful themselves. The Bees’ frontmen have not allowed opponents much rest so far and after they combined to down Wolves last week, Thomas Frank felt moved to compare them with Dwight Yorke and Andy Cole. That particular combination gave Liverpool plenty to fear back in the day: now their would-be modern equivalents have a chance to take the next scalp in Brentford’s remarkable rise.
